This month, I’ve been taking part in the Ultimate Blog Challenge. The idea behind the challenge is to write and post 31 blog posts in the month of October. It is great to have goals — and as of now – I’m only one post behind. The other part of the Blog Challenge (which is proving to be very useful) is sharing the posts on Twitter. Each post is tagged with #blogboost and several of the participants (including me) go through each day and retweet posts from people in the challenge.
The trick is to spread the posts out through the day. In the video below, I show you a free web service called Buffer App (the link is a referral link – I get extra tweets beyond my 10 a day for everyone who checks it out). Buffer App creates a queue of tweets that is releases on a schedule that you choose. With the Firefox and Chrome extensions you can add things to your buffer in less than 5 seconds. It only takes me 5 minutes to go through and set up my retweets in the morning (the video shows you how). I’ve been doing this for a week and have picked up 100 new followers on Twitter and my Klout score has increased — plus, I enjoy helping people out.
